RPHAX
Hardware accelerator prototyper
An automation framework to quickly prototype and integrate hardware accelerators on Xilinx FPGAs
RPHAX provides a quick automation flow to develop and prototype hardware accelerators on Xilinx FPGAs. Currently, the framework has support for AXI-Stream IP with Single Master and Single Slave Template. The user can code the Hardware Accelerator in TL-Verilog/Verilog/System Verilog and use this flow to automatically package into an IP and create a Zynq based block design.
16 stars
3 watching
0 forks
Language: Tcl
last commit: over 1 year ago
Linked from 1 awesome list
Related projects:
Repository | Description | Stars |
---|---|---|
stanford-ppl/spatial | A toolset for designing and implementing reconfigurable hardware acceleration using high-level abstraction | 274 |
nvdla/hw | The NVDLA project provides hardware designs and tools for building deep learning inference accelerators. | 1,744 |
roberttlange/gymnax | A framework that accelerates RL environment processes by leveraging JAX and GPU acceleration | 650 |
pulp-platform/axi | Provides reusable IP modules and verification infrastructure for designing high-performance on-chip communication networks adhering to AXI standards. | 1,106 |
ferrandi/panda-bambu | A framework for designing and optimizing hardware accelerators for complex software applications. | 243 |
deepakkumar1984/amplifier.net | A .NET library that enables developers to run complex applications on various hardware platforms without writing additional C kernel code. | 175 |
xilinx/finn | Fast and scalable neural network inference framework for FPGAs. | 747 |
supranational/sppark | A high-performance library for accelerating zero-knowledge proof generation operations on GPUs | 185 |
esa-tu-darmstadt/tapasco | A framework for integrating FPGA-based accelerators into heterogeneous systems and connecting them to host CPUs and external memory. | 106 |
iffix/machin | An open-source reinforcement learning library for PyTorch, providing a simple and clear implementation of various algorithms. | 401 |
rbowler/spinhawk | Provides a C implementation of the Hercules mainframe virtualization platform for Point-to-Point connections. | 101 |
philtomson/rhdl | A Ruby-based language for describing digital hardware components and their behavior. | 14 |
xilinx/pynq | Enables the development of high-performance embedded systems using programmable logic and microprocessors | 1,993 |
xilinx/logicnets | Designs and deploys neural networks integrated with Xilinx FPGAs for high-throughput applications | 83 |
chipsalliance/fpga-tool-perf | Analyzes performance of tools used in Field-Programmable Gate Arrays (FPGAs) | 102 |